A fixing jig helps make the process of installing new hinges easy and precise. The jig will pre-drill the holes for the pin-locating holes and screw holes on the hinge body and the door sash. After drilling the screw and pin-locating holes, place the hinges and add packs if necessary to ensure they are positioned correctly on the uPVC door profile. Once the hinges are properly positioned and packed then drill the screws into place and screw them securely to the door sash and the hinge body.

With a flag hinge, you can adjust the height, width and depth of uPVC uPVC that is more than the capabilities of a Butt hinge or T hinge. You may have to remove the caps from the adjustment screws of the hinge before you can adjust the door. Different manufacturers might order the screws differently, so it is crucial to know which screws are used when you adjust.

In addition, to ensure that your uPVC doors close and open without a hitch, it is crucial to examine the hinges' compression on a regular basis. The sash could separate from the frame which can lead to air leaks or poor weatherproofing. To avoid this you can adjust the hinges by loosening the screw that is in the middle of the compression adjustment using an Allen key. You can add or take away shims to change the compression. This will ensure that your uPVC doors will remain in the right place.
